I shouldn't say this but you can cut your way down and create a slope down to the bottom. your thinking like someone who has only used a shovel and not an excavator. Dig out a little better then 30 inches or so on the side where you have barney sitting CREATING A RAMP . Then you take some of the diggings/spoils and infill so you can drive barney into the hole . drive in so far until you can reach the other side and start digging placing your spoils somewhere that they won't block you in or where you can't get to them latter. Maybe take it down only 6 inches and use that 6" to build up around the outside of the excavation? Instead of a foot of stone go with only 8 inches of stone . 8 inches is deep enough where you won't walk across it and see the rubber bellow. Once you have dug the depth work your way back out the hole compacting soil with the bucket of the excavator on the way out. OR use that ramp to bring your fabric down and rubber fabric and place the blocks just as you would have with the full square ignoring the ramp. place all the milk crates and once the Cistern is blocked in and fabric is wrapped around it then start your back fill of the ramp Just be careful even barney can blow through the milk crates and rubber like it was a Tonka toy. Or just hire a operator for a day throw them a couple hundred and be done with it.
